Full particulars may be obtained from the Stores Manager’s Branch, Ministry of Works, Wellington (Telephone 46-084, ext. 847). 8216 LYTTELTON HARBOUR BOARD TENDER FOR TRANSIT SHED CONTRACT NO. 1193 TENDERS will be received until 4 p.m. on FRIDAY, OCTOBER 8. 1965, for the construction, completion and maintenance in accordance with all the terms and conditions of the Contract, of the steel skeleton for a 600 ft x 120 ft transit shed on the Cashin Quay area of Lyttelton Harbour.

The main steel framing will consist of 120 ft span portal frames with an additional 25ft verandah. The purlins are to be of latticed tubular construction while side framing, etc., is to be made from rolled sections. All steelwork is to be dry sandblasted before painting. The drawings and specifications may be viewed at the Board’s Offices, 297 Madras street, Christchurch, and copies may be obtained on receipt of a deposit of £lO (refundable) on receipt of a bona fide tender). The tenders are to be addressed to the SecretaryManager, Lyttelton Harbour Board, P.O. Box 2108, Christchurch, and must be endorsed on the envelope "TENDER FOR TRANSIT SHED.” The lowest or any tender will not necessarily be accepted. A. J. SOWDEN, Secretary-Manager.
